Nutrition for Mental Health: Building a Brain-Boosting Diet
Your intellect’s function is deeply linked to what you ingest. A balanced diet isn't just about bodily wellness ; it’s a vital component in boosting mental resilience . Focusing on unprocessed foods can greatly enhance your mood . Here are some key areas to focus on :
- Omega-3 Fatty Acids : Found in oily seafood, flaxseeds, and pecans , they promote neural health.
- Complex Carbohydrates : Like oats, wholewheat bread, and sweet potatoes , provide stable blood sugar and stabilize mood.
- Fruits & Vegetables : Cherries , leafy greens , and other deeply colored produce shield the brain from damage.
- Gut-Friendly Foods: Yogurt and other probiotic sources nurture gut health , which affects brain function .
Keep in mind that nutrition plays a vital function in your mental wellbeing. Working with a healthcare professional can offer tailored advice for your individual needs .

Key Vitamins for a Clear Mind
Nourishing your intellect for optimal clarity requires more than just balanced nutrition; certain elements play a particularly significant role. Many deficiencies can affect cognitive abilities , leading to challenges with focus. Here's a overview at some key vitamins for cognitive well-being:
- Vitamin B12 : Supports brain health and cell formation, critical for energy .
- Vitamin D : Linked to mood regulation and cognitive performance.
- Omega-3s : Though technically fatty acids , they're commonly considered alongside vitamins due to their benefits on cognitive development .
- Vitamin C : A powerful free radical scavenger that assists defend the intellect from damage .
- Vitamin E : Another free radical scavenger that promotes general cognitive health .
Ensuring a eating plan rich in these vitamins – through natural sources or, if needed , additions – can help to a clearer and effective intellect . Always consulting with a doctor before starting any additional vitamin regimen .
